cannonade

/ˈkænəˌneɪd/
IPA guide

Other forms: cannonading; cannonaded; cannonades

Definitions of cannonade
  1. noun
    intense and continuous artillery fire
    synonyms: drumfire
    see moresee less
    type of:
    artillery fire, cannon fire
    fire delivered by artillery
  2. verb
    attack with cannons or artillery
    see moresee less
    type of:
    assail, attack
    launch an attack or assault on; begin hostilities or start warfare with
